Your Role
As an AI-driven Change & Release Coordinator with Capgemini, you will ensure the smooth and controlled delivery of operational changes and releases across live environments. Leveraging AI across the full change / release lifecycle to accelerate innovation and deliver value at scale, you will coordinate planning, resources, and version control while minimizing risk and maintaining quality. Working closely with DevSecOps, project, and third-party teams, you will optimize deployments, support transitions to business-as-usual, and drive effective execution across the full release lifecycle, ensuring KPIs and service commitments are met.
In this role you will:
- Coordinate the operational changes and releases of all live service elements, with focus on planning, coordination of resources and activities, and version controlling, whilst maintaining quality and minimizing risk.
- Ensure that Release and Change Management Key Performance Indicators (KPIs) are reported, and their targets are met
- Coordinate with DevSecOps Engineers and other technical teams for deployments, automation improvements and release optimization.
- Collaborate with project and operational teams to ensure effective system change and release implementation.
- Assist in support models set up and in managing transition of projects and new services into the business-as-usual model.
- Coordinate with suppliers, contractors, 3rd parties, etc. to ensure timely change and release implementation and contractual fulfilment, when applicable
Your Profile
- Excellent understanding and practical knowledge of ITIL service management processes, including Incident, Problem, Change, Release, Event and Knowledge Management.
- Proficiency with IT service management tools as defined or agreed by the Contracting Authority.
- Understanding of CI/CD pipelines and configuration-management tools.
- Strong coordination and analytical skills.
- Ability to communicate effectively and work in a multicultural, multi-vendor operational environment.
- Excellent ability to manage multiple high priority efforts/ competing priorities and flexibility to adjust to changing requirements, schedules and priorities.
- Demonstrated expertise in embedding AI into delivery practices and guiding teams to adopt AI‑powered approaches responsibly and at scale.
- Excellent communication skills in English, both written and spoken. Good knowledge of French will be a strong differentiator.
- Willingness to undergo background checks.
